Lavaca County
Lavaca County has lower-than-average household income, with a median household income of $41,429. Population has held roughly steady since 2000. 14%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 28%. Median home value is $83,100. With a median age of 45.2, the population is older than the US median of 37.2.

How many people live in Lavaca County, Texas?
Lavaca County, Texas has about 19,263 residents according to the 2010 American Community Survey.
What is the median household income in Lavaca County, Texas?
The typical household in Lavaca County, Texas earns about $41,429 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.
Is Lavaca County, Texas expensive?
In Lavaca County, Texas, the median home is worth about $83,100, and the typical rent is about $522 a month.
How educated are people in Lavaca County, Texas?
About 14.0% of adults age 25 and over in Lavaca County, Texas h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
What is the poverty rate in Lavaca County, Texas?
About 10.5% of people in Lavaca County, Texas live below the federal poverty line.
Has Lavaca County, Texas grown since 1990?
Yes, Lavaca County, Texas has grown since 1990. The population has added about 573 residents, a change of about 3 percent over that period.
